What Is the Official Trézor® Bridge?
The Official Trézor® Bridge is a lightweight, secure communication layer developed by Trezor’s creators, SatoshiLabs. It serves as the bridge between your Trezor hardware wallet and the tools you use to manage your crypto — including browsers and the trezor suite desktop/web app.
Historically, Trezor relied on browser extensions to communicate with your hardware wallet. Those browser plugins were limited in compatibility and security. By contrast, the Trezor Bridge runs as a local background service on your computer, offering broader support across browsers and operating systems, and eliminating the need for legacy extensions.
In simple terms, when you connect your hardware wallet via USB, the Trezor Bridge translates that connection into secure communication pathways so you can safely manage your assets with trezor suite or other supported tools.

How Trezor Bridge Works
After installing the Official Trezor Bridge, it runs silently in the background whenever your Trezor wallet is connected, intercepting and translating communication signals between the hardware and the trezor suite interface or supported web apps.
Here’s a simplified flow:
Connect your Trezor device via USB.
Trezor Bridge detects the device and establishes a secure channel.
Your browser or trezor suite sends encrypted commands through Bridge.
Bridge forwards these commands securely to the Trezor hardware wallet.
The hardware wallet performs sensitive operations, such as signing transactions, without exposing your private keys.
This secure workflow enables the highest level of confidence while managing funds.

When Do You Need Trezor Bridge?
You need the Official Trezor Bridge when:
✔ You’re accessing trezor suite in a browser that doesn’t have native USB support. ✔ You want seamless hardware wallet detection and communication. ✔ You’re using web-based wallets or dApps that require hardware signing.
If you are using the trezor suite desktop app, Bridge may already be bundled or not required, as trezor suite handles connectivity internally.
